Web25 jul. 2024 · The left subcardinal veins coalesce to form the left renal vein and left gonadal vein. The right subcardinal vein becomes the renal portion of the inferior vena cava. We get ejected ... five oaks farm house tnWeb17 feb. 2024 · Like arteriovenous malformations elsewhere in the body, a renal AVM is formed by a connection between the arterial and venous structures, without flowing through a capillary bed. An AVM has a vascular nidus.
